What “rights” are involved in publication?

As an author, you always retain the “rights” to your creation – unless, for some odd reason, you sell every right imaginable away to another party. 

 

When the publication of your work is in question you offer (sell) rights to the publisher.  “Rights” can be defined in many contractual ways.  The rights I request upon publication of your work are as follows:

 

            Great Kills Press - Great Kills Review  (periodical)

·         The author offers the rights to Great Kills Press (heretofore referred to as “GKP”) to publish his/her work in periodical form in Great Kills Review (heretofore referred to as “GKR”) with the understanding that while said work is published, online, in the current edition of GKR, that the author will not have said work published elsewhere.

·         The day upon which the next edition of GKR is published and made available to the public on GreatKillsPress.com marks the beginning of the author’s agreed upon time for having said work published elsewhere with the understanding that “previously published credit” will be made to GKR upon publication of said material in another publication.

·         The author offers the rights to GKP to publish his/her work in the “Archives” section of GreatKillsPress.com.  The “Archives” section will contain the original edition of GKR in which the author’s work was published.

How do I need to format my submission?

 

Include the following items at the beginning of your email:

·         Full Name

·         Mailing Address

·         Email Address

·         Brief Bio

·         Publishing Credits

·         The following statement: “I attest that the work I am submitting for consideration is entirely original and of my own creation.”

·         Your submitted work must be pasted to the body of the email.  Attachments will not be opened.  Upon acceptance of your work you will be asked to send the same work as an email attachment in MSWord format – only then will attachments be opened.

Do you accept simultaneous submissions?

Yes.  However, should your work be accepted for publication while still under consideration by Great Kills Press, it is your responsibility to inform the editor of GKP as publication of your work while it is also published elsewhere is not what we want.  See “What ‘Rights’ are involved in Publication?” above for more on this.

What happens after my work is accepted for publication?

I search through submissions for works that reflect the style I envision for GKR.  When and if your work is accepted for publication, it will then enter the editing process.  There is a fine thread that runs throughout my journal and your work might need a tweak here and a pinch there in order to ensure its appropriate place on that thread.  Thus begins the editing process.  This process will involve both of us and requires your open mind.
